December 19. Kazakhstan Today - Owing to the right economic strategy and the created stocks of gold and exchange currency reserve of the National Fund we can resist, smooth cyclic recessions of economic without special efforts and provide stable growth of the country. The President of Kazakhstan Nursultan Nazarbayev said addressing the solemn assembly devoted to the 16th anniversary of independence of the Republic, the agency reports.
"Gold and exchange currency reserves of the country, including the resources of the National Fund total $40 billion. We did everything so that public finances and private bank system became tolerant to external shocks," N. Nazarbayev emphasized.
"Having gone through two tests, today our economy is under the influence of new crisis, which has swept the world due to difficulties in hypothecary sector of the USA. In conditions when there were cases of default, even bankruptcies of some large financial institutions in the West, the Kazakhstan financial system has proved to be stable and effectively functioning," the President emphasized.
"Prompt growth of our economy promotes growth of manufacture and consumption. It increases its need for investments. In this connection, the government and the National Bank have carried the detailed analysis of influence of external conjuncture and developed counter-measures," N. Nazarbayev said.
